{"product_id":"9780128045275","title":"Geometric Measure Theory: A Beginner's Guide","description":"Geometric measure theory is the mathematical framework for the study of crystal growth, the geometry of clusters of soap bubbles, and similar structures involving minimization of surface energy. Beautiful mathematics comes into play when a group of bubbles forms a cluster and physically solves the complicated mathematical problem of minimizing surface energy.
